Output 87b80afcd58059925106f6a2495ea80f73b85377b547d2f45d1d8d91494f5f24:11

value
1315380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afdb6e5ce852c3d18d3b96e7b8f1f6084999818 OP_EQUAL
address
3BSjVGQRGYS36LqwAbsXJrCHAVfUBhAcPt
transaction
87b80afcd58059925106f6a2495ea80f73b85377b547d2f45d1d8d91494f5f24
confirmations
281853
spent
true